What is the oldest PSP model?
Models are arranged chronologically.
- PSP-1000 "Phat/Fat" (2004-2007)
- PSP-2000 "Slim" (2007-2008)
- PSP-3000 "Slim & Lite" or "Brite" (2008-2014)
- PSP-N1000 "Go" (2009-2011)
- PSP-E1000 "Street" (2011-2014)

The PlayStation Vita (PS Vita) is a handheld game console developed and marketed by Sony Computer Entertainment. It was first released in Japan on December 17, 2011, and in North America, Europe, and other international territories on February 22, 2012.How do I know if my PSP is 2000 or 3000?
There are a couple of ways:
- PSP 1000s and 2000s have the Sony logo on the top right of the console, while the 3000 has the logo on the top left.
- PSP 1000s and 2000s have a "fat" silver ring on the back of the console, while the 3000 has a very thin one.
